Reposted
If you turned 50 Raleigh outs into hits, he'd still have a lower AVG than Judge's .331

Flip 68 Raleigh outs into times on base and his OBP would still be lower than Judge's .457

Josh Naylor was great (.490 SLG), Raleigh outslugged him by 99 points (.589), Judge outslugged Raleigh by 99 (.688)
Cal Raleigh had an exceptional year. Good for MVP in a great many seasons. In my view, this wasn't particularly close though. Judge is doing absolute freak shit at the plate, but he's been doing it so consistently that it doesn't feel that crazy anymore. Which is nuts!
